You can iron a shower curtain without much trouble so long as it is an exterior, decorative shower curtain and not your plastic liner. You can iron many types of polyester, but you'll need to take a few precautions. Iron any creases or wrinkles. Luckily, there are a few ways that you can remove wrinkles from a polyester item without damaging the fabric, such as washing and drying it, ironing on low heat, or steaming the fabric.
